Three Brothers '44


In this 1944 cartoon, SNAFU learns that every job, no matter how apparently dull, boring, and useless is important.

He also falls prey to the usual "grass is greener" fallacy, but our good pal Technical Fairy 1st Class sets him straight as usual.

Overall a pretty unremarkable toon, with the ideas having been much better played out in "Infantry Blues."  Although SNAFU's voice-mate, Bugs Bunny makes a voice-less cameo.

Sure are an awful lot of guys named Benny and Charlie in his unit, too!

Spies (Aug. 1943)

In 1943's Spies, Private Snafu learns the dangers of combining alcohol and military secrets, no matter how insignificant. How's that go again? Loose lips and something or other... Click through for the toon.

The History of Private Snafu

Private Snafu is the title character of a series of black-and-white American instructional cartoon shorts produced between 1943 and 1945 during World War II. The character was created by director Frank Capra, chairman of the U.S. Army Air Force First Motion Picture Unit, and some of the shorts were written by Theodor "Dr. Seuss" Geisel. Although the United States Army gave Walt Disney Studios the first crack at creating the cartoons, Leon Schlesinger of the Warner Bros. animation studio underbid Disney by two-thirds and won the contract.
